What you'll be doing day to day

  • Supporting senior colleagues in activities ranging from preparing corporation tax computations and returns to advisory work such as capital allowances, R&D claims, tax due diligence and transaction / restructuring reports
  • Assist with the development of junior staff through day-to-day support and mentoring 
  • Undertaking tax technical research for wider projects  
  • Undertaking a number of tax related administrative tasks  
  • Becoming involved with the marketing and business development efforts of the team  
  • Helping to build and maintain contact with clients, HMRC, other accountancy, law and professional services firms, in the delivery of an excellent client service
  • Working alongside audit colleagues on annual tax assignments  

About you

  • 2+ years of previous experience in a corporation tax compliance role
  • ATT/CTA or ACA/CTA qualified (or equivalent), or part-qualified with relevant experience and interest in studying for CTA
  • Excellent up to date technical knowledge 
  • Be fully aware and conversant with compliance standards imposed by the various regulatory authorities for tax and audit 
  • Commercially astute, with a keen analytical and problem-solving mind 
  • Organised and able to plan time efficiently in order to meet deadlines 
  • Ability to work independently, or as part of a team 
  • Strong interpersonal skills and ability to build rapport quickly with clients 
  • Professional and discreet in demonstrating client care 
  • Previous experience of Alphatax would be useful
